A 2021 review published in Biomedicine & Pharmacotherapy explains that silymarin, the main active compound in milk thistle, can:25 Regulate the cell cycle, helping to ensure proper division and replication Induce apoptosis, or programmed cell death, by which the body can eliminate mutated cells (e.g., cancer cells) Regulate the body's immune response, increasing its ability to recognize and attack cancer cells Keep tumor cells from growing and spreading Inhibit angiogenesis, the process by which tumors create new blood vessels that increase their blood supply and help them grow The review specifically discusses silymarin's therapeutic potential for gastrointestinal cancer, but as another set of researchers note, silymarin has a pleiotropic effect, meaning it can act on multiple targets.26 Again, more research may be needed, but the current science suggests that milk thistle may have fairly broad complementary utility in cancer therapy
